Bowling

KidsBowlFree.com - A summer long program where Kids that are registered can bowl 2 games DAILY from June 1st to October 1st. You can also purchase a Family pass for $24.95. This is good for up to 4 adult family members (Mom, Dad, Older Siblings, Grandma, Grandpa or an Adult Babysitter) to bowl 2 games of bowling every day during the promotion all summer long along with the children that have registered in your family.  Kids can bowl from 9am-9pm and standard shoe rental rates may apply.

Local participating centers include Coram Country Lanes, East Islip Lanes, Port Jeff Bowl Inc, and Bowl Long Island At Patchogue,

AMF Summer Games Pass allows children ages 15 and under to bowl all summer long for a fraction of the cost. With their pass, children can bowl three games weekdays (Mon-Fri) from open until 8 pm and weekends (Sat & Sun) from open until 4 pm at participating centers. The program begins May 18, 2015, and lasts all summer long until Labor Day, September 7, 2015. Pass prices vary by location and are valid only at the center selected during registration. READING PROGRAMS

Barnes & Noble Summer Reading Program for 2015
Imagination's Destination:

- Kids in grades 1-6 can earn a free book, a summer reading kit, and more.
- Simply read any 8 books and record them in the Reading Journal
- Bring the completed Reading Journal to Barnes & Noble in Lake Grove
- Then your child gets to choose a FREE book from a selection on the Reading Journal List at the store.

The Scholastic Summer Reading Challenge
is a free online reading program for children. Join today and let’s set a new reading world record for summer 2015! (May 4 - Sept 4, 2015)


TD Bank's Summer Reading Program
- If your child is in grades K-5, participating is easy!
- Have your child read 10 books this summer
- Print out the Summer Reading Form- Write down the names of the books they've read
- Take the form to the nearest TD Bank - Receive $10 in a new or existing Young Saver account
